द्विघात समीकरण \(ax^2+bx+c=0\) में (a) के लिए आवश्यक शर्त क्या है?

What is the required condition for (a) in \(ax^2+bx+c=0\)?

Explanation opens after your attempt
Correct Answer

C. \(a\neq 0\)

Step 1

Concept

If (a=0), the \(x^2\) term disappears. So \(a\neq 0\) is necessary for a quadratic equation.
